Finyoz, the lendtech platform specializing in
short-term invoice financing, has joined forces with Currencycloud, a service
provider in simplifying business transactions across multiple currencies. This
strategic partnership aims to potentially advance supply chain financing,
utilizing modern technology and financial expertise.
Investment Flexibility through the Collaboration
Finyoz's platform acts as a bridge between companies seeking
short-term invoice financing solutions and private or corporate treasury
investors. Through an intuitive online interface, companies can upload
invoices, view financing fees, and communicate with debtors.
Investors, in turn, gain access to a curated selection of investment
opportunities spanning periods from 14 to 90 days, receiving interest payments
throughout the investment period.

The collaboration with Currencycloud introduces a pivotal
enhancement to Finyoz's offering. Investors now have the flexibility to collect
funds in their preferred currency, which can then be converted to
the currency of the borrower. Currencycloud's expertise in managing
multi-currency transactions empowers investors to navigate global financial
markets with ease. Additionally, investors can leverage digital wallets
provided by Currencycloud to efficiently deploy funds across various investment
avenues.
Corporate Treasury Advantages in Global Operations
Thorsten de Jong, CEO of Finyoz Deutschland GmBH, Source: LinkedIn
Notably, Finyoz's corporate treasury clients stand to
benefit significantly from the partnership with Currencycloud. By
tapping into Currencycloud's extensive global ecosystem, these clients can
optimize payment cycles and streamline international currency transfers. This
integration aims to enhance operational efficiency and unlock new opportunities
for businesses operating in a global marketplace.
